Job Description

What This Job Involves

We are seeking an Analyst – Talent Acquisition Support to join a highly collaborative, fast-paced shared services team delivering exceptional talent acquisition support across EMEA (covering over 30 countries). This role is strongly focused on end-to-end recruitment support, systems administration, and first-line query resolution, ensuring a seamless experience for candidates, recruiters, and hiring managers.

As a Talent Acquisition Support Analyst, you will combine hands-on ATS/Workday expertise with strong customer service and process discipline. You will act as a key enabler of hiring activity by supporting recruiters with operational excellence, maintaining data accuracy, resolving Tier 1 TA-related queries, and continuously improving hiring processes and candidate experience.

This role offers the opportunity to make a tangible impact on service delivery, compliance, and the effectiveness of talent acquisition operations across the region.

Key Responsibilities

Talent Acquisition Operations & Support

  • Provide centralized administrative and operational support to the Talent Acquisition team across EMEA.
  • Act as first-line support for Talent Acquisition–related queries from recruiters, hiring managers, HR partners, and candidates.
  • Manage TA-related cases through case management tools (e.g., HR Direct / ServiceNow), ensuring timely and accurate resolution.
  • Support recruiters with interview scheduling for internal and external candidates.
  • Create, distribute, and track electronic offers, internal transfers, and related documentation where applicable.
  • Collect, verify, and maintain Right to Work documentation in line with local compliance requirements.
  • Partner closely with HR Operations to ensure smooth onboarding for all new hires.

Systems & Data Management

  • Serve as a Workday / ATS specialist and champion, supporting recruiters and hiring managers in navigating and effectively using the system.
  • Maintain accurate recruitment data, including job requisitions, candidate records, offer details, and status updates.
  • Perform data corrections, transaction rescinds, audits, and system-related requests within defined procedures.
  • Support semi-functional system issues, mass uploads, validations, and data quality checks, escalating complex issues as required.
  • Update related reports, and proactively communicate strategies and needed actions to ensure smooth onboarding process for applicants, proper coordination of onboarding activities and overall performance within recruitment project timelines.
  • Ensure adherence to compliance standards, SOPs, and audit requirements throughout the hiring lifecycle.
  • Update related reports, and proactively communicate strategies and needed actions to ensure smooth onboarding process for applicants, proper coordination of onboarding activities and overall performance within recruitment project timelines.

Process Excellence & Continuous Improvement

  • Demonstrate strong knowledge of TA processes, policies, and standard operating procedures.
  • Identify opportunities to improve recruitment workflows, candidate experience, and system utilization.
  • Assist with updating SOPs, process maps, and knowledgebase documentation related to Talent Acquisition support.
  • Participate in regional or global TA initiatives, transitions, and process enhancements.
  • Perform quality checks on key recruitment transactions in line with defined quality frameworks.
  • Adhere to agreed KPIs, SLAs, and customer service standards.

Stakeholder & Service Management

  • Communicate clearly and professionally with stakeholders across EMEA and globally.
  • Manage multiple priorities while supporting recruiters, HR partners, and candidates in a fast-paced environment.
  • Act as a bridge between Talent Acquisition, HR Operations, and system support teams when required.
